ssSNPer: identifying statistically similar SNPs to aid interpretation of genetic association studies. |
|
ABSTRACT |
|
UNLABELLED |
|
ssSNPer is a novel user-friendly web interface that provides easy determination of the number and location of untested HapMap SNPs, in the region surrounding a tested HapMap SNP, which are statistically similar and would thus produce comparable and perhaps more significant association results. Identification of ssSNPs can have crucial implications for the interpretation of the initial association results and the design of follow-up studies. |
